: One of the stocks I own just completed a merger with
: another company (actually they were acquired). I own
: 100 shares of the original company ("A") and received
: 1.1 shares of "B" for each share of "A". I think I
: know how to get through this correctly, but I wanted
: to check and be sure.

: Pointers?

: Thanks.
: Barry

Hi Barry,
You could handle it a couple of different ways.
One is to treat it similar to a spin-off and
create a new investment. See:

http://www.fundmanagersoftware.com/spin.html

Another option is to record a split and change
the name of that existing investment.
